Trichosanthes dunniana H.Lév., Repert. Spec. Nov. Regni Veg. 10: 148 (1911) ;
.
Sikkim to S. Central China (to Guangxi) and Indo-China: Assam, China South-Central, China Southeast, East Himalaya, Laos, Myanmar, Thailand as per POWO;
